What was China’s population policy?
Restricting family sizes from 3 children to 1 child.
What happened to the legal marriage age?
It was increased to 22 for men and 20 for women; applications to the government had to be made before a marriage.
Why did people follow the population policy?
- forced abortions and sterilisations.
- incentives: free education, healthcare, housing, and jobs.
- 5-10% salary increase.

Mexican push factors compared to American pull factors:
- high crime rates: 47.5 thousand deaths in 5 years.
- poor medical facilities: 1800 people per doctor - 400 people per doctor
- low paid jobs: GNP of $4000 - $25000
- poor literacy rate: 55% - 99%
- school leaving age: 14 - 16.
- corruption in the government.
- unemployment: 40%
- poverty: 44.2%
Impacts on Mexico:
- fewer economically active people.
- increased dependant population.
- $6 billion per year sent to Mexico.
- pressures on services are reduced.
- gender inequality.
Impacts on the USA?
- money spent on border patrol and prison.
- improved cultural awareness - Spanish is now taught
- drug related crime increase.
